The DSM501A PM2.5 Dust Sensor is an advanced air quality sensor designed to detect particulate matter (PM) in the air, specifically PM2.5 particles, which are fine particles less than 2.5 microns in diameter. These particles can pose significant health risks, making this sensor ideal for air quality monitoring systems in homes, offices, factories, and industrial environments. The DSM501A provides precise readings of dust concentration in real-time, enabling users to track air pollution levels and take necessary actions to improve indoor air quality.

DSM501A Specifications
- Detection Range: 0 to 500 µg/m³ (PM2.5 concentration)
- Output: Analog and PWM output for easy interface with microcontrollers.
- Operating Voltage: 5V DC
